    Fun little boot store with a big Texas personality
    Cobra Rock is owned by a very kind couple who hand makes boots in-store that are sold in limited runs worldwide. They also sell a very well-curated collection of jackets and other apparel for men and women that complements their boots and overall aesthetic. Both of the owners are incredibly kind and helpful, and are happy to share their recommendations on their favorites in town. Their story is also interesting and contributes to the whole experience. I didn't mean to leave with an order for a pair of their handmade boots, but alas I did. Note that they don't really sell their boots in store, but accept pre-orders that then ship once they're done. (The clothing/apparel can be bought and taken home the same day). This shop is currently featured on/in trendy blogs and magazines whenever they mention Marfa. It's a "must" for anyone who is into fashion.
